Raapsteeltjes
This is a classic recipe from the Van Zuylen (Timmer?) family. It was Ellen's favorite food when she was growing up.The recipe says that we should feed the roots of the turnip greens to the rabbits, but we didn't as we have had some bad experiences lately with leaving our garbage outside and are trying to discourage ugly wildlife (what kind of animal is grey-ish, as big as a big cat, round, and has a white triangle on its face?) to come close to our home.

I can't really cook.
I've of course known this for a long time -- all I do is chop vegetables, make a vinaigrette or so, and clean up the mess, and I leave the actual cooking to Frans. However, Frans kept insisting that I can indeed cook. Today I had an opportunity to prove him wrong, Frans himself being too sick to cook (he seems to have the flu').
So I made some pesto, which turned out so-so because half the basil had to be thrown out, and the pesto consequently had too much garlic, because I failed to take this into account. Then I cooked some tortellini and allowed them to get cold while I made the pork chops, which were not ruined as such, but not exactly high quality either.
I can't wait till Frans gets well, so I can just concentrate on chopping (and eating).

There's a first time for everything...
... and today was the first time we ordered pizza delivery. (Really?? Yes, really!)
Of course we chose a bit of an inopportune evening for this first-time-pizza-delivery, since the "super" bowl has everyone ordering pizza today. So we had to curb our hunger for an hour by making some fries (since being dutch means we always have enough potatoes around).

Eventually, our pizza did arrive. And of course we already knew this, but Sindbad makes a pretty darn good pizza.
